An IT Annual Maintenance Contract (AMC) is a service agreement between a business and an IT service provider. Under this contract, the provider offers regular maintenance and support for the organization’s IT infrastructure, including hardware, software, networks, and other critical components. The contract typically covers a specific period, usually one year, with the option for renewal.
